Flat ro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of the roof’s surface to identify potential issues that could lead to leaks, water damage, or structural problems. During an inspection, service providers will examine the roof for signs of damage such as cracks, blisters, ponding water, or areas where the roofing material may be deteriorating. They also check for proper drainage, flashing integrity, and any debris or obstructions that could compromise the roof’s performance. Regular inspections help homeowners stay ahead of issues before they develop into costly repairs, ensuring the roof remains in good condition and continues to protect the property effectively.

This service is especially valuable for diagnosing problems caused by age, weather exposure, or improper installation. Flat roofs are more susceptible to pooling water and damage from standing water, which can lead to leaks and roof failure if not addressed promptly. An inspection can reveal early warning signs like soft spots, bubbling, or cracks that indicate the need for repairs or maintenance. Catching these issues early can prevent water from seeping into the building, reducing the risk of interior damage, mold growth, and more extensive repairs down the line.

Many types of properties benefit from flat roof inspections, including commercial buildings, apartment complexes, and residential homes with flat or low-slope roofs. These roofs are common in urban areas and in structures where space efficiency is a priority. Homeowners with flat roofs should consider regular inspections, especially after severe weather events or if they notice signs of leaks or water pooling. Property managers and business owners also rely on inspections to maintain the integrity of their roofs and avoid disruptions caused by unexpected roof failures.

The overview below groups typical Flat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in American Fork, UT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ine inspections and minor repairs on flat roofs generally range from $250-$600. Many common maintenance j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the roof size and repair needs.

Moderate Projects - When more extensive repairs or localized patching are required, costs often fall between $600-$1,500. Larger or more complex projects tend to push into this range more frequently than smaller jobs.

Full Roof Replacement - Replacing an entire flat roof usually costs between $4,000-$8,000, with larger or more intricate systems potentially exceeding $10,000. Many full replacements are at the higher end of this spectrum, especially for larger commercial roofs.

Complex or Custom Work - Projects involving structural modifications or custom materials can reach $10,000+ in costs. These are less common and represent the highest tier of typical flat roof services handled by local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why should I schedule a flat roof inspection? Regular inspections help identify potential issues early, preventing costly repairs and extending the lifespan of the roof.

What signs indicate my flat roof needs an inspection? Visible ponding, leaks, or damaged membrane are common signs that a professional inspection may be necessary.

How often should a flat roof be inspected? It is recommended to have a flat roof inspected at least once a year or after severe weather events.

What do flat roof inspections typically include? Inspections usually involve checking for surface damage, membrane integrity, drainage issues, and signs of wear or deterioration.
